    A couple of days ago I finally could get my hands on the final pieces I needed to start work on the last unit for my army. My Kaisenor Lancers, or as you might know them, the Tichi-Huichi Raiders of old. I continued the theme of my Battle-Captain and went for a mix of old and new, changing shields and weapons, this serves a dual purpose. First durability (plastic is so much better for long, thin weapons) and secondly aesthetics as I wanted to make them feel part of the army and not feel out of place, so I got (not without effort) a bunch of Ripperdactyls weapons and shields and started converting them into this mix of old and new:

    The newest Cold ones are just dreadful, these while a pain to work with can be much better looking.

    I haven't used epoxy but I did pin EVERYTHING, every single part has a damn pin in it, it's so time consuming.... and the gaps! my god those gaps!

    Have spent a whole day of work to just clen every mold line and putty 4 cold ones, it's really frustrating.

    I'm now considering if I should glue the riders now so I can take care of the gaps on the saddle... it's going to be a pain to paint but I'm npt sure I can live withthose gaps.
